520 | _ | _ | |a In this work some methods for preparation of lanthanum aluminate bulk ceramics were compared. High purity lanthanum aluminate LaAlO3 (LAO) ceramic samples of high density (>94%) were prepared via three different routes and the morphology, chemical and electrical properties of the samples were investigated. For high purity samples a sol-gel route A. Douy and P. Odier [1] and a thermal nitrate decomposition route Shaji Kumar et al. [2] were introduced to reduce unintentional doping by the preparation process to a minimum. As a standard route the mixed oxide process was chosen. In sol-gel and nitrate decomposition procedures the formation temperature of LaAlO3 from its oxides was lowered by using reactive gamma-alumina from the pyrolysis of initial aluminium nitrate instead of commonly used alpha-alumina (corundum) in the mixed oxide process. No commercial gamma-alumina of sufficient purity is known.Differences in the electrical behaviour of the samples were measured, indicating some correlations between the samples' different morphology, purity and its' preparation parameters. |
